需求变更文档是什么文档

需求变更文档是什么文档

需求变更文档是一种记录和跟踪项目或产品需求变化的文档。它通常包括变更的详细描述、变更的原因、变更的影响评估、变更的批准记录和相关的实施计划。需求变更文档的核心作用在于确保所有利益相关者对变更有一致的理解、避免由于需求变更带来的项目混乱、帮助项目团队评估变更对项目的影响。其中,确保所有利益相关者对变更有一致的理解尤为重要。通过记录详细的变更描述和原因,需求变更文档可以帮助团队成员和利益相关者清楚地了解变更的内容和目的,从而减少沟通误解和冲突。

一、需求变更文档的定义和重要性

需求变更文档是项目管理中不可或缺的一部分。它主要用于记录项目需求在项目生命周期中发生的任何变更。这些变更可能来自客户的新需求、市场变化、技术进步或项目团队内部的优化建议。无论变更的来源如何,需求变更文档都能帮助团队清楚地记录和跟踪这些变更。

需求变更文档的重要性体现在以下几个方面:

  1. 明确变更内容和原因:记录变更的详细信息,确保所有相关人员对变更有一致的理解。
  2. 评估变更影响:通过对变更的影响进行评估,帮助团队了解变更对项目进度、成本和质量的影响。
  3. 规范变更流程:通过变更文档,确保变更的流程规范化,避免随意变更导致的项目混乱。
  4. 保持项目透明度:变更文档可以提高项目透明度,让所有利益相关者了解项目的最新进展和变更情况。

二、需求变更文档的主要内容

需求变更文档通常包括以下几个主要内容:

  1. 变更描述:详细描述变更的内容,包括变更的具体需求和期望的结果。
  2. 变更原因:说明变更的原因,如客户的新需求、市场变化或技术进步等。
  3. 变更影响评估:评估变更对项目进度、成本、质量和风险的影响。
  4. 变更审批记录:记录变更的审批情况,包括审批人、审批时间和审批意见等。
  5. 变更实施计划:详细说明变更的实施计划,包括实施步骤、时间安排和责任人等。

三、需求变更文档的编写流程

编写需求变更文档的流程通常包括以下几个步骤:

  1. 变更提出:项目团队或客户提出需求变更,并填写变更申请表。
  2. 变更评估:项目管理团队对变更进行评估,分析变更的必要性和可行性。
  3. 变更审批:将变更申请提交给项目经理或变更控制委员会进行审批,审批通过后记录审批情况。
  4. 变更实施:根据变更实施计划,项目团队执行变更,确保变更顺利实施。
  5. 变更验证:变更实施后,项目团队对变更进行验证,确保变更达到预期效果。

四、需求变更文档的管理工具

为了更好地管理需求变更文档,可以使用一些专业的工具和软件。例如,PingCodeWorktile是国内市场占有率非常高的需求管理工具和项目管理系统,可以帮助团队高效管理需求变更文档。

  1. PingCode:PingCode是一款专业的需求管理工具,提供了全面的需求变更管理功能。通过PingCode,团队可以方便地记录和跟踪需求变更,进行变更影响评估和审批流程管理。【PingCode官网

  2. Worktile:Worktile是一款通用型的项目管理系统,支持需求变更管理。通过Worktile,团队可以高效管理项目需求变更文档,确保变更流程的规范化和透明度。【Worktile官网

五、需求变更文档的常见问题和解决方法

在编写和管理需求变更文档的过程中,可能会遇到一些常见问题。以下是几种常见问题及其解决方法:

  1. 需求变更频繁:需求变更频繁可能导致项目进度延误和成本增加。解决方法是建立严格的变更控制流程,确保只有必要的变更才能通过审批。

  2. 变更影响评估不准确:不准确的变更影响评估可能导致项目风险增加。解决方法是引入专业的评估工具和方法,如风险分析和成本评估等,确保评估的准确性。

  3. 变更沟通不畅:变更沟通不畅可能导致团队成员对变更理解不一致。解决方法是通过需求变更文档详细记录变更内容和原因,并定期召开变更沟通会议,确保所有相关人员对变更有一致的理解。

六、需求变更文档的最佳实践

为了更好地编写和管理需求变更文档,可以参考以下几个最佳实践:

  1. 及时记录变更:一旦需求变更发生,应及时记录变更内容和原因,确保变更文档的及时性和准确性。
  2. 定期更新文档:定期更新需求变更文档,确保文档内容与项目实际情况一致。
  3. 建立变更控制流程:建立严格的变更控制流程,确保变更的审批和实施过程规范化。
  4. 使用专业工具:使用专业的需求管理工具和项目管理系统,如PingCode和Worktile,提高需求变更文档的管理效率。
  5. 加强变更沟通:定期召开变更沟通会议,确保所有相关人员对变更有一致的理解和认识。

七、需求变更文档在项目管理中的作用

需求变更文档在项目管理中起着重要作用,主要体现在以下几个方面:

  1. 提高项目透明度:通过需求变更文档,项目团队和利益相关者可以清楚了解项目的最新进展和变更情况,提高项目透明度。
  2. 确保项目一致性:需求变更文档可以帮助团队保持对项目需求的一致理解,避免由于需求变更带来的项目混乱。
  3. 促进项目沟通:需求变更文档可以作为变更沟通的基础,促进团队成员和利益相关者之间的沟通和协作。
  4. 降低项目风险:通过详细记录和评估需求变更,需求变更文档可以帮助团队识别和管理项目风险,降低项目失败的可能性。

八、总结

需求变更文档是项目管理中不可或缺的重要文档。它不仅记录和跟踪项目需求的变化,还能帮助团队评估变更的影响,确保变更流程的规范化和透明度。通过及时记录变更、定期更新文档、建立变更控制流程和使用专业工具,项目团队可以更好地管理需求变更文档,提高项目管理的效率和成功率。推荐使用PingCode和Worktile等专业的需求管理工具和项目管理系统,帮助团队高效管理需求变更文档。

相关问答FAQs:

1. 什么是需求变更文档?
需求变更文档是一种记录和管理软件开发项目中需求变更的文档。它包含了在项目开发过程中发生的需求变更的详细描述、原因、影响以及相应的解决方案。这些变更可能涉及功能、性能、界面、安全性等方面的改动。

2. 需求变更文档的作用是什么?
需求变更文档的主要作用是确保项目开发过程中的需求变更得到有效的管理和控制。它能够帮助项目团队追踪和记录变更请求,及时评估变更的影响,并确定是否接受或拒绝变更。通过需求变更文档,团队成员可以更好地理解和沟通变更需求,减少沟通误差,提高项目的开发效率和质量。

3. 如何编写一份有效的需求变更文档?
编写一份有效的需求变更文档需要注意以下几点:

  • 确定变更的原因和背景,包括变更请求的发起人和时间。
  • 详细描述变更的内容和要求,包括新增、修改或删除的功能、界面或性能等。
  • 分析变更对项目进度、成本和质量的影响,包括变更的优先级和紧急程度。
  • 提供解决方案和建议,包括变更的实施计划和资源需求。
  • 征求相关方的意见和反馈,包括开发团队、测试团队和项目经理等。
  • 定期审查和更新需求变更文档,确保其与实际变更保持一致。

原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/5188826

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部